> On Sun, Aug 18, 2013 at 09:55:11AM -0700, Richard Sharpe wrote:
> > Correct. We ran into problems however because we have a snapshot
> > driver that presents snapshots under the same folder as the share. It
> > returns ENOTSUP if you try to set an XATTR on a file in the snapshot
> > file system. (Actually, the VFS does because we don't implement that
> > function.)
>
> The variable is around for performance. Obviously this hits
> you badly. Maybe it's time to remove this check and just
> always try xattrs if not explicitly disallowed in the
> configuration?

That's what we did ...
